Vendor Notes

This exquisite Dong Fang Mei Ren presents a captivating aroma of sweet honey, intermingled with hints of resinous pine. On the palate, it unfolds with a substantial, mouth-filling body, revealing a symphony of honeyed sweetness, a subtle yeasty warmth, and the gentle tang of goji berries, culminating in a woody spice finish.

How should I brew Dong Fang Mei Ren 2022?
Water around 85–95 °C (185–205 °F). In a mug, steep 3–4 min. For gongfu, use 5–7 g per 100 ml, 10–30 s steeps (8–15 rounds). You'll get to see how the flavor changes across multiple rounds. Heavier roasts can take boiling water no problem.
